【发布时间】:2017-04-07 05:51:34
【问题描述】:
我想在管道成功完成后触发 webhook,我查看了触发器列表并没有找到任何解决方法,是否可以通过管道手动触发 webhook?
【问题讨论】:
标签: bitbucket bitbucket-pipelines
我想在管道成功完成后触发 webhook,我查看了触发器列表并没有找到任何解决方法,是否可以通过管道手动触发 webhook?
【问题讨论】:
标签: bitbucket bitbucket-pipelines
您可以使用 Build status updated 触发器来触发基于管道构建的 webhook。但是,这也会由 INPROGRESS 或 FAILED 状态触发,并且无法指定管道。
如果您只想在特定管道成功完成时触发 webhook,您可以通过将必要的命令添加到您的 bitbucket-pipelines.yaml 文件来手动执行此操作。
如果您的管道中有多个并行步骤,则应在单独的串行步骤中添加 webhook 触发器,以便它仅在所有并行步骤完成后运行。
【讨论】: